    An Auckland developer has been fined more than 80-thousand dollars - for building unsafe apartments


    John Liong Kiat Wong pleaded guilty to four charges of breaching the Building Act and RMA in Auckland District Court.

    It was found Wong had converted an Eden Terrace warehouse into an office and apartment building, without consent.

    Two years ago - a concrete block fell from the building on to a neighbour's roof - narrowly missing a skylight.

    Basic safety features, like smoke detectors and fire sprinklers, were also missing a warrant of fitness.
